meteor-linkedin-api:流星框架的 Linkedin 接口封装

需积分: 9 0 下载量 11 浏览量 更新于2024-10-30 收藏 5KB ZIP 举报
资源摘要信息: "meteor-linkedin-api:链接 api 的流星包装器" 知识点: 1.流星连接蛋白(Meteor)简介: 流星连接蛋白(Meteor)是一个开源的全栈JavaScript平台,用于开发响应快速的web和移动应用。它支持实时数据同步,并且具备一个活跃的社区和广泛的插件生态。Meteor将前端和后端的开发工作流统一了起来,使得开发人员可以使用JavaScript进行从前端用户界面到后端服务器的编码工作。 2.流星包装器(Library)概念: 流星包装器是将外部库或API封装成可以轻松集成到Meteor应用中的模块。通过使用包装器,开发人员可以更加容易地将第三方服务和功能集成到Meteor项目中,实现快速开发。 3Linkedin API: Linkedin API是一种允许应用程序访问Linkedin网络数据和功能的接口。开发者可以利用Linkedin API实现用户认证、数据检索、内容分享等操作。通过这些API,开发者可以构建出与Linkedin平台深度集成的应用程序。 4.流星的Linkedin包装器安装和配置: 该文档中提到的khamoud:linkedin-api是流星的一个包装器,旨在为流星开发人员提供一个方便的方式来使用Linkedin API。 - 安装:开发者可以将此包装器添加到应用的meteor/packages文件中或者使用命令meteor add khamoud:linkedin-api将其集成到项目中。 - 初始化和访问令牌:在使用Linkedin API之前,开发者必须先进行初始化并设置访问令牌。这通常涉及到Linkedin的OAuth认证流程,开发者需要事先从Linkedin平台获取访问令牌,以获得API调用权限。 5.Linkedin包装器的使用方法: - 创建Linkedin实例:通过调用Linkedin().init方法,并传入访问令牌,初始化Linkedin实例。 - 调用端点:初始化完成后,即可调用Linkedin实例的端点来执行所需的操作,如获取用户信息、发布帖子等。 6.配置选项: - timeout:在初始化Linkedin实例时,可以指定timeout选项来设定HTTP请求的超时时间,单位为毫秒。默认超时时间为60秒。 7.文件名称列表说明: - meteor-linkedin-api-master:这是流星包装器项目的压缩包名称,通常表示该项目代码的主分支或者稳定版本。 总结: 本资源摘要介绍了流星连接蛋白(Meteor)、Linkedin API以及流星的Linkedin API包装器的安装、配置和使用方法。这对于希望在Meteor项目中集成Linkedin功能的JavaScript开发者是一个宝贵的资源。掌握如何通过这个包装器利用Linkedin API,可以帮助开发者拓展他们的应用功能,实现更丰富的社交网络集成。